Locations, Aliases

Location aliases can be set using the little 'AKA' label under the location name. You can set as many aliases as you want for a location, but you should use aliases that relate to the name of the location, not to describe it. If you want to describe it, use tags.

Aliases are used as a shortcut to referencing locations in console commands. Instead of having to reference the full, canonical name of a place, you can just use an alias. Plus, this is how we tend to reference places naturally, and makes more sense.
